Wamble & Associates, PLLC is a consulting and design firm that provides professional services to land developers, real estate firms, contractors, landowners, attorneys, architects, private industry, and government agencies.


Since our inception in 1984, we’ve performed civil engineering, land survey, and/or land planning services on more than 2500 residential and commercial projects in the middle Tennessee area.

Civil Engineering

We have extensive experience in creative site design for a wide variety of residential, commercial, and industrial projects.  We provide a full range of services including the design of grading, drainage, utilities, roads, detention basins, erosion control, water quality treatment, and parking lots.  We also provide engineering studies, cost estimates, and constructability analysis on proposed projects.

 

  • Single and Multi-Family Residential Subdivisions

  • Commercial Site Plans

  • Industrial Site Plans

  • Urban Designs

  • Construction Documents

  • Construction Site Inspection

  • Certification of Contractors’ Pay Requests

Land Surveying

We have an experienced staff of office and field personnel who utilize GPS and CAD technology to ensure accurate and dependable results.  Land surveying services include:

 

  • Boundary Surveys

  • Topographic Surveys

  • “As-Built” Surveys

  • Route Surveys

  • ALTA Land Title Surveys

  • Flood Elevation

  • Aerial Ground Control

  • Legal Descriptions

  • Final Plats

  • Construction Staking
